Seriously considering trading up from my current 2014 Subaru Forester XT Touring to an MDX.

Here's the Forester:



It's a good car for what it is, and it's been good to me for the last year, but the driver's seat is the most uncomfortable thing I think I've ever sat in.

Never seriously considered the importance of researching driver's seat comfort, but I also never thought it was possible to create a seat this uncomfortable. One just cannot seem to get the adjustments to the right spot. It's as if the seat is mounted at a bad angle, or the seat itself is just built wrong. The whole thing just results in me having lower back pain on any trip longer than 30 minutes, which is why I didn't catch this during the test drive. Lots of other Forester drivers have since confirmed the same thing, but I'd already purchased the car at that point.

I've also thoroughly looked into whether this is a recalled issue or can be fixed in some way. Turns out this is known to be normal for this generation of Foresters, and it isn't an "issue" at all, but rather just that the seat isn't comfortable for everyone. Some folks have altered the padding in the seat, some have gotten in there and changed the lumbar adjustment mechanics, and a few even went to the extreme and completely remounted the driver's seat using spacers or longer bolts to permanently change the angle. I don't think it's as simple as adding or removing padding, I've unsuccessfully tried using lower back cushions while driving, and I'm not willing to screw with the seat mountings.

I think I'm just done messing with it. I know I'll lose money (since I bought the Forester new), but I've been considering trading up to an MDX, probably used from around 2008 or so, as that would fit my budget. The only reason I ever looked into the Forester was because the current generation CR-V is ugly, but otherwise I've always been a Honda guy. I'm finally looking beyond the CR-V to Acura, and I have yet to find any reports of driver's seat discomfort for the MDX.

Anyone have thoughts or similar experiences with driver's seat comfort/discomfort in a Forester or MDX?

I don't find the Forester comfortable either, but I'm a fairly big dude and generally don't like small cars. The big difference is the width...the MDX is about 8" wider which is huge in car dimensions. It's also about a foot longer. And half a ton heavier. So it drives completely different, although acceleration is similar....if you're drag-racing anyway. MPG is going to be a pretty big decrease for you.

The MDX seats are pretty comfortable. Hardly the most comfy vehicle I've owned but they're not bad. Seat comfort is very subjective so I always make sure I get a long test drive in before buying. I would suggest the same.
